Handover: FD leak hunt on the Brindlewick ingest service. Confirmed descriptors climb ~40/hour under load; lsof points at orphaned pipe pairs from the Tarn sandbox wrapper. Repro script is in my scratch branch. Not yet ruled out: the retry path in the archive fetcher. Security angle: leaked FDs may expose sandboxed file handles cross-tenant. Full timeline and captures are on the internal page below.

operations page: https://vault.qorvelcorp.example/settings

Step 4: Verify feature parity between the Norrel SDK for Kestrel and the legacy Plover client. Confirm that pagination cursors, offline caching, and the retry budget behave identically before flipping traffic. Run the parity suite twice, once per client, and diff the emitted traces. Once both runs pass, apply the settings below to the staging gateway exactly as written.

config for kafof-bawef:
holath:
  log_level: debug
  metrics_host: metrics.holath.qorvelsys.internal
  pin: 2191
  pool_size: 32

// WEBHOOK_ENDPOINT_PARCELTRACK
//
// This constant points at the Murkwood Logistics parcel-tracking
// webhook receiver. Release manager: do not change this value
// without bumping the contract version in the Skylark gateway,
// or deliveries will silently drop status updates. Verification
// against staging happens during the cut. The build token for the
// verified artifact appears directly below.

trace token, fafog-kageg: htk4_98e6

Ticket: Configuration drift in ProfileVault shard map

Plugin authors integrating with ProfileVault should be aware that the user-profile store was resharded last week from 8 to 32 logical shards. Two edge nodes are still serving the old shard map, which can cause stale reads for plugins that cache routing hints. Please do not hardcode shard counts. Until the drift is resolved, validate your plugin against the canonical settings below.

service settings:
PRAIX_LOG_LEVEL=error
PRAIX_METRICS_HOST=metrics.praix.qorvelcorp.corp
PRAIX_POOL_SIZE=16